* Re: [PATCH 00/13] ibmvfc: initial MQ development
From: Tyrel Datwyler @ 2020-12-02 17:19 UTC (permalink / raw)
  To: Hannes Reinecke, james.bottomley
  Cc: brking, linuxppc-dev, linux-scsi, martin.petersen, linux-kernel
In-Reply-To: <90e9a8ac-d2b9-bb64-7c7d-607adaea0f26@suse.de>

On 12/2/20 4:03 AM, Hannes Reinecke wrote:
> On 11/26/20 2:48 AM, Tyrel Datwyler wrote:
>> Recent updates in pHyp Firmware and VIOS releases provide new infrastructure
>> towards enabling Subordinate Command Response Queues (Sub-CRQs) such that each
>> Sub-CRQ is a channel backed by an actual hardware queue in the FC stack on the
>> partner VIOS. Sub-CRQs are registered with the firmware via hypercalls and then
>> negotiated with the VIOS via new Management Datagrams (MADs) for channel setup.
>>
>> This initial implementation adds the necessary Sub-CRQ framework and implements
>> the new MADs for negotiating and assigning a set of Sub-CRQs to associated VIOS
>> HW backed channels. The event pool and locking still leverages the legacy single
>> queue implementation, and as such lock contention is problematic when increasing
>> the number of queues. However, this initial work demonstrates a 1.2x factor
>> increase in IOPs when configured with two HW queues despite lock contention.
>>
> Why do you still hold the hold lock during submission?

Proof of concept.

> An initial check on the submission code path didn't reveal anything obvious, so
> it _should_ be possible to drop the host lock there.

Its used to protect the event pool and the event free/sent lists. This could
probably have its own lock instead of the host lock.

> Or at least move it into the submission function itself to avoid lock
> contention. Hmm?

I have a followup patch to do that, but I didn't see any change in performance.
I've got another patch I'm finishing that provides dedicated event pools for
each subqueue such that they will no longer have any dependency on the host lock.

-Tyrel

* Re: [PATCH v9 0/6] KASAN for powerpc64 radix
From: Andrey Konovalov @ 2020-12-02 15:11 UTC (permalink / raw)
  To: Daniel Axtens
  Cc: Christophe Leroy, Aneesh Kumar K.V, LKML, kasan-dev,
	Linux Memory Management List, PowerPC
In-Reply-To: <20201201161632.1234753-1-dja@axtens.net>

On Tue, Dec 1, 2020 at 5:16 PM Daniel Axtens <dja@axtens.net> wrote:
>
> Building on the work of Christophe, Aneesh and Balbir, I've ported
> KASAN to 64-bit Book3S kernels running on the Radix MMU.
>
> This is a significant reworking of the previous versions. Instead of
> the previous approach which supported inline instrumentation, this
> series provides only outline instrumentation.
>
> To get around the problem of accessing the shadow region inside code we run
> with translations off (in 'real mode'), we we restrict checking to when
> translations are enabled. This is done via a new hook in the kasan core and
> by excluding larger quantites of arch code from instrumentation. The upside
> is that we no longer require that you be able to specify the amount of
> physically contiguous memory on the system at compile time. Hopefully this
> is a better trade-off. More details in patch 6.
>
> kexec works. Both 64k and 4k pages work. Running as a KVM host works, but
> nothing in arch/powerpc/kvm is instrumented. It's also potentially a bit
> fragile - if any real mode code paths call out to instrumented code, things
> will go boom.
>
> There are 4 failing KUnit tests:
>
> kasan_stack_oob, kasan_alloca_oob_left & kasan_alloca_oob_right - these are
> due to not supporting inline instrumentation.
>
> kasan_global_oob - gcc puts the ASAN init code in a section called
> '.init_array'. Powerpc64 module loading code goes through and _renames_ any
> section beginning with '.init' to begin with '_init' in order to avoid some
> complexities around our 24-bit indirect jumps. This means it renames
> '.init_array' to '_init_array', and the generic module loading code then
> fails to recognise the section as a constructor and thus doesn't run
> it. This hack dates back to 2003 and so I'm not going to try to unpick it
> in this series. (I suspect this may have previously worked if the code
> ended up in .ctors rather than .init_array but I don't keep my old binaries
> around so I have no real way of checking.)

Hi Daniel,

Just FYI: there's a number of KASAN-related patches in the mm tree
right now, so this series will need to be rebased. Onto mm or onto
5.11-rc1 one it's been released.

Thanks!

On 12/2/20 1:52 AM, Alexey Kardashevskiy wrote:
> From: Oliver O'Halloran <oohall@gmail.com>
> 
> When a passthrough IO adapter is removed from a pseries machine using hash
> MMU and the XIVE interrupt mode, the POWER hypervisor expects the guest OS
> to clear all page table entries related to the adapter. If some are still
> present, the RTAS call which isolates the PCI slot returns error 9001
> "valid outstanding translations" and the removal of the IO adapter fails.
> This is because when the PHBs are scanned, Linux maps automatically the
> INTx interrupts in the Linux interrupt number space but these are never
> removed.
> 
> This problem can be fixed by adding the corresponding unmap operation when
> the device is removed. There's no pcibios_* hook for the remove case, but
> the same effect can be achieved using a bus notifier.
> 
> Because INTx are shared among PHBs (and potentially across the system),
> this adds tracking of virq to unmap them only when the last user is gone.
> 
> Signed-off-by: Oliver O'Halloran <oohall@gmail.com>
> [aik: added refcounter]
> Signed-off-by: Alexey Kardashevskiy <aik@ozlabs.ru>


Reviewed-by: Cédric Le Goater <clg@kaod.org>

I did some PHB hotplug tests on a KVM guest and a LPAR using only LSIs.

Tested-by: Cédric Le Goater <clg@kaod.org>

Thanks Alexey,

C.
